Assessment and Planning

Within 60 minutes of your call, our team will arrive to assess the damage and create a plan to extract the Category 3 water. This includes identifying the source, testing the water for contaminants, and determining the best extraction method.

Water Extraction

Our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ract the Category 3 water, taking care to prevent further damage and contamination. This may involve using submersible pumps, wet vacuums, or other equipment to remove the water quickly and efficiently.

Drying and Dehumidification

After the water has been extracted, our team will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ify the affected area. This includes using indust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to remove any remaining moisture and prevent further damage.

Disinfection and Cleaning

Once the area is dry, our team will disinfect and clean the affected area to prevent any further health risks. This includes using spec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to remove any remaining contaminants and restore the area to its original state.

Final Inspection and Report

After the restoration process is complete,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that the area is safe and dry. We’ll provide a detailed report of the work completed, including before and after photos, to ensure you’re satisfied with the results.

Warning Signs You Need Black Water Extraction (Category 3)

Catching these warning signs early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ent further damage. Don’t ignore these signs:

Discoloration and Warping of Floors and Walls

When you notice discoloration or warping of floors and walls, it’s a sign that the water has penetrated the surface, causing damage to the underlying material. This can lead to costly repairs and even structural issues if left unaddressed.

Unpleasant Odors

Musty odors or a sweet, chemical smell can show the presence of Category 3 water. These odors can linger for weeks or even months if not addressed, causing discomfort and health concerns.

Visible Water Damage

Water stains, warping, or buckling of flooring, walls, or ceilings are clear signs of Category 3 water damage. If you notice any of these signs, it’s essential to address the issue immediately to prevent further damage.

Health Concerns

Category 3 water can contain contaminants like sewage, chemicals, or even toxic substances that pose serious health risks. If you’re experiencing skin irritation, respiratory issues, or other health concerns, it’s a sign that you need Black Water Extraction (Category 3) services.

Difficulty with Plumbing Fixtures

Leaks, clogs, or difficulty with plumbing fixtures can show a more significant issue, such as Category 3 water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to costly repairs and even safety hazards.

Electricity and Short Circuits

Water and electricity can be a deadly combination. If you notice flickering lights, sparks, or other electrical issues, it’s a sign that you need Black Water Extraction (Category 3) services to prevent electrocution and further damage.

Common Questions About Black Water Extraction (Category 3)

What is Black Water Extraction (Category 3)?

Black Water Extraction (Category 3) is the process of removing Category 3 water, which contains contaminants like sewage, chemicals, or toxic substances, from a property to prevent further damage and health risks.

How Long Does Black Water Extraction (Category 3) Take?

The time it takes to complete Black Water Extraction (Category 3) depends on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the equipment needed. Typically, it takes 3-5 days to complete the process.
